What Is a “Winning Product”?

A winning product is not just something popular—it is a product that meets multiple success factors at the same time:

  • High and consistent demand

  • Strong profit margin

  • Low-to-medium competition

  • Reliable supplier availability

  • Easy shipping and fulfillment

  • Strong social media or impulse-buy potential

The Hoobuy Spreadsheet helps you measure these factors in one place instead of relying on intuition.

Step 1: Build Your Product Research Framework

Before adding products, you need a clear structure inside your spreadsheet.

Include columns such as:

  • Product Name

  • Product Category

  • Supplier Link

  • Cost Price

  • Shipping Cost

  • Estimated Selling Price

  • Profit Margin

  • Demand Score

  • Notes

This framework turns raw data into actionable insights.

Step 2: Collect Product Ideas from Multiple Sources

Winning products rarely come from one place. Use multiple discovery channels:

  • TikTok viral trends

  • Amazon “Best Sellers” lists

  • AliExpress trending items

  • Competitor stores

  • Facebook Ads Library

  • Niche communities and forums

Every potential product should be logged immediately into your spreadsheet.

Step 3: Filter Products Using Data (Not Emotion)

Once products are added, the spreadsheet becomes a filtering tool.

Focus on:

Profitability

  • Remove low-margin products immediately

  • Set a minimum profit threshold (e.g., 25%+)

Demand

  • Look for consistent engagement or search interest

  • Avoid one-time viral spikes unless supported by trend data

Competition

  • Check how many stores are selling the same item

  • Prefer products with moderate competition

Data removes guesswork and increases accuracy.

Step 4: Compare Suppliers Strategically

A winning product depends heavily on supplier quality.

Inside the spreadsheet, compare:

  • Price differences

  • Shipping time

  • Product quality ratings

  • Return/replacement policies

  • Communication speed

Sometimes the same product can have completely different profitability depending on the supplier.

Step 5: Score Each Product

To simplify decision-making, assign a scoring system.

Example:

  • Demand (1–10)

  • Profitability (1–10)

  • Competition (1–10)

  • Shipping speed (1–10)

Add total scores and prioritize the highest-ranking products.

This turns your spreadsheet into a product ranking engine.

Step 6: Validate Products Before Scaling

Before committing to large orders or ads:

  • Test small quantities

  • Run low-budget ads

  • Monitor conversion rates

  • Check customer feedback

Only scale products that show real performance, not just spreadsheet potential.

Step 7: Track Performance in Real Time

A winning product is not static. It evolves.

Update your spreadsheet with:

  • Actual sales data

  • Ad performance metrics

  • Return rates

  • Customer feedback

  • Supplier consistency

This helps you decide whether to scale, adjust, or remove a product.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

Many beginners fail not because of lack of effort, but because of poor structure.

Avoid:

  • Adding too many unverified products

  • Ignoring shipping costs

  • Overestimating demand

  • Using outdated pricing

  • Skipping product testing

  • Relying only on “viral” trends

A clean spreadsheet is more powerful than a large messy one.
